## Deployment

The drift-probe service for the Tallowgate cron investigation deploys as a single container behind the internal scheduler mesh. It samples tick timestamps from each worker node and writes deltas to the audit store every five minutes. Rollout is blue-green; the probe tolerates a restart mid-window without losing samples. Reviewers should confirm that the sampling cadence matches the incident hypothesis before approving. The deployment reads the following configuration at startup.

deployment values, kajep-kageg:
[praix]
host = praix.paliqcorp.corp
user = praix_svc
database = praix_prod

## Sensor drift: what to do at 3am

If the GrowLoop controller starts reporting humidity swings that don't match the backup probes in the Fernwick greenhouse, it's almost always sensor drift, not an actual climate event. Don't panic and don't touch the vents manually. First, restart the calibration daemon and give it ten minutes to re-baseline. If readings still disagree by more than 5%, flip the controller into safe mode. The safe-mode thresholds it will use are these.

config for yahap-bajof:
[istix]
host = istix.qorvelsys.internal
user = istix_svc
database = istix_prod

Minutes — Management Meeting, Supplier Contract Renewal

Present: department heads; chaired by R. Onnesby.

The Garwick Components contract expires at quarter-end. Procurement reported a proposed 5% uplift with improved delivery terms. Quality flagged two recent batch issues; Garwick has committed to corrective audits. Decision: renew for eighteen months pending legal review, with a dual-sourcing study to run in parallel. The confidential note on related business plans appears below these minutes.

internal memo for yajeg-kagep: Novysax Systems is in early talks to buy Tamdorek Systems for about $21.4 million. The Normir launch date is June 28, and nothing goes to the press before then.

## Formula sandbox tuning

User-supplied formulas in Gridmoor execute inside a restricted interpreter with hard ceilings on time, memory, and call depth. Reviewers should confirm any change to these ceilings is justified in the PR description, since raising them widens the abuse surface. Defaults were chosen from production traces. The current limits are as follows.

limits module of tafog-fawip:
WEIGHTS = {
    "julix": 57,
    "lamys": 992,
    "kasvan": 209,
    "quenok": 750,
    "alddor": 259,
    "oliath": 1009,
    "wenix": 815,
}